共 11 篇文章

标签:仓库

Win7 64下如何搭建SVN服务器? (svn服务器搭建 win7 64)-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

Win7 64下如何搭建SVN服务器? (svn服务器搭建 win7 64)

在Windows 7 64位操作系统下搭建SVN(Subversion)服务器,可以通过以下步骤来完成。, 准备工作, ,1、确保你的Windows 7系统已经安装了.NET Framework 3.5以上版本,因为VisualSVN Server依赖于此框架。,2、安装VisualSVN Server,你可以从官方网站下载VisualSVN Server的最新版本。,3、准备一个用于存储代码仓库的文件夹路径, D:Repositories。, 安装VisualSVN Server,1、运行下载的VisualSVN安装程序。,2、按照安装向导的提示完成安装过程。, 配置VisualSVN Server,1、启动VisualSVN Server Manager。,2、在左侧的Repository列表中,右键选择“Add Repository”。,3、在弹出的对话框中输入 仓库名称,选择仓库类型(FSFS或BDB),并设置仓库的存储位置为你之前准备的路径。,4、点击“OK”创建仓库。, , 设置用户权限,1、在VisualSVN Server Manager中,选择你创建的仓库。,2、切换到“Users”选项卡。,3、添加新用户,并设置其访问权限。, 配置SVN客户端,1、在客户端计算机上安装SVN客户端,例如TortoiseSVN。,2、使用管理员提供的URL、用户名和密码,通过SVN客户端检出(Checkout)代码库。, 测试SVN服务器,1、在仓库中创建一个文件或目录。,2、使用SVN客户端提交(Commit)这个更改。,3、检查是否能成功检出(Checkout)最新更改。, ,至此,SVN服务器就搭建完成了,你可以开始使用它来管理你的代码版本了。, 相关问题与解答,1、 问:VisualSVN Server是否免费?,答:VisualSVN Server有免费的社区版和收费的商业版,对于小型团队和个人使用,社区版通常足够了。,2、 问:我能否不使用VisualSVN Server,直接在Windows上安装SVN?,答:可以,但是VisualSVN Server是一个集成了多种工具和服务的完整解决方案,使得安装和管理SVN变得更加简单,如果你熟悉SVN的命令行工具,也可以选择手动安装。,3、 问:如何备份SVN仓库?,答:你可以简单地复制仓库的物理存储目录来进行备份,对于使用FSFS格式的仓库,只需备份存储数据的文件即可,对于BDB格式的仓库,需要备份所有相关的数据库文件。,4、 问:如果我想迁移现有的SVN仓库到新的服务器怎么办?,答:你需要将现有仓库的物理存储文件复制到新服务器上相应的位置,确保新服务器上的VisualSVN Server指向正确的存储路径,更新客户端的仓库URL以指向新服务器。,

网站运维
win10搭建git服务器-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

win10搭建git服务器

在Windows下搭建Git服务器,Git是一个分布式版本控制系统,它可以帮助我们更好地管理和跟踪代码的变更,在团队协作开发中,我们通常会使用Git来管理代码,而搭建一个Git服务器,可以让团队成员更方便地进行代码的提交、拉取和合并等操作,本文将介绍如何在Windows下搭建一个简单的Git服务器。, ,1、安装Git,我们需要在Windows系统上安装Git,可以从Git官网(https://git-scm.com/)下载对应的安装包,然后按照提示进行安装。,2、创建Git仓库,安装完成后,我们可以在本地创建一个Git仓库,打开命令行工具,进入到你想要创建仓库的目录,然后执行以下命令:,这将在当前目录下创建一个名为 .git的隐藏文件夹,用于存放Git仓库的相关文件。,3、添加文件到仓库,接下来,我们需要将项目文件添加到Git仓库中,可以使用以下命令将所有文件添加到仓库:,如果只想添加某个文件,可以将 .替换为文件名。, ,4、提交文件到仓库,添加文件到仓库后,我们需要提交这些文件,可以使用以下命令进行提交:,这将把添加的文件提交到仓库,并附带一条提交信息,以后每次提交时,都需要使用这个命令。,5、配置Git服务器,为了搭建Git服务器,我们需要配置Git服务器的相关参数,打开命令行工具,进入到 .git文件夹,然后执行以下命令:,这将设置你的用户名和邮箱地址,这些信息将被用于提交记录中的作者信息。,6、初始化远程仓库,接下来,我们需要初始化一个远程仓库,可以使用以下命令创建一个名为 origin的远程仓库:, ,请将 yourusername和 yourrepository替换为你在GitHub上创建的用户名和仓库名,如果你还没有创建GitHub仓库,可以先访问GitHub官网(https://github.com/)进行创建。,7、推送代码到远程仓库,我们需要将本地仓库的代码推送到远程仓库,可以使用以下命令进行推送:,这将把本地仓库的代码推送到远程仓库的 master分支,以后每次提交代码后,都需要使用这个命令将代码推送到远程仓库。,至此,我们已经在Windows下搭建了一个简单的Git服务器,团队成员可以通过克隆远程仓库的方式,获取到最新的代码,他们也可以将自己的代码提交到远程仓库,实现团队协作开发。,

网站运维
如何在git服务器上创建新项目? (git服务器上创建项目)-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

如何在git服务器上创建新项目? (git服务器上创建项目)

在Git服务器上创建新项目是版本控制和团队协作的重要步骤,以下是详细的步骤和技术介绍,以帮助您顺利地在Git服务器上创建新项目。,1、准备工作, ,在开始之前,确保您已经安装了Git,并且拥有访问Git服务器的权限,通常,这涉及到SSH密钥的设置,以便安全地从您的本地计算机连接到远程服务器。,2、在服务器上创建 仓库,登录到您的Git服务器,通常是通过SSH进行连接,导航到您希望创建新项目的目录,使用以下命令来初始化一个新的Git仓库:,这里, project_name应替换为您的项目名称。 --bare选项用于创建不带工作副本的裸仓库,这对于作为中央仓库来说是必须的。,3、本地准备,在本地计算机上,创建一个新的文件夹以对应您的新项目,并打开一个终端或命令提示符窗口。,4、配置本地仓库,在本地文件夹中初始化Git,并将其与远程仓库关联起来。,在这里, server_url是您Git服务器的URL, project_name是您在服务器上创建的仓库的名称。, ,5、提交文件,现在,您可以开始添加文件到本地仓库,并将它们提交到服务器。,这将创建一个 README.md文件,将其添加到Git跟踪列表中,提交更改,并将它们推送到远程服务器。,6、团队成员协作,一旦项目设置完成,其他团队成员可以克隆这个仓库到他们自己的计算机上,并进行更改和贡献。,7、管理分支和合并,为了有效地管理特性开发和修复错误,您可能需要使用分支,团队成员可以创建自己的分支,完成后再将它们合并回主分支。,相关问题与解答,Q1: 如果我想为项目添加多个远程仓库怎么办?, ,A1: 您可以使用 git remote add命令多次,为同一个项目添加多个远程仓库。,Q2: 我如何管理团队成员对项目的访问权限?,A2: 在服务器端,您可以设置文件系统的权限,以及通过Git的钩子(hooks)来管理谁可以推送到特定分支。,Q3: 如果我不小心推送了错误的提交,如何撤销?,A3: 您可以使用 git revert创建一个新的提交来撤销之前的更改,或者使用 git reset重置您的本地分支。,Q4: 我如何保持我的本地仓库与远程仓库同步?,A4: 定期拉取( git pull)或推送( git push)更改可以保持同步,使用 git fetch可以获取远程仓库的最新状态但不合并。,以上就是在Git服务器上创建新项目的详细步骤和技术介绍,希望这些信息能够帮助您和您的团队更高效地进行协作开发。,

网站运维
美国免费主机试用怎么搭建网站-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

美国免费主机试用怎么搭建网站

在开始之前,我们需要了解美国免费主机的基本概念,免费主机是指提供免费服务的网络托管公司,用户可以在其提供的服务器上放置自己的网站文件,以便让全球的用户可以通过互联网访问,这些免费主机通常会有一定的限制,如流量、存储空间等,但对于初学者和个人网站来说,已经足够使用。,下面我们将以GitHub Pages为例,介绍如何在美国免费主机上搭建网站,GitHub Pages是GitHub提供的一个免费服务,允许用户将自己的静态网站托管在GitHub上,以下是搭建网站的步骤:, ,1、注册GitHub账号,你需要注册一个GitHub账号,如果已经有账号,可以跳过这一步,访问https://github.com/,点击“Sign up”进行注册。,2、创建一个新的仓库,登录GitHub后,点击右上角的“+”号,选择“New repository”,给仓库起个名字,my-free-host-website”,然后按照提示完成仓库的创建。,3、将本地项目推送到GitHub仓库,在本地计算机上创建一个新的文件夹,用于存放你的网站文件,打开命令行工具(如Windows的cmd或PowerShell,Mac和Linux的终端),执行以下命令将本地项目推送到GitHub仓库:,注意:将其中的 your_username和 your_repository替换为你的GitHub用户名和仓库名。,4、配置GitHub Pages,在你的GitHub仓库页面,找到“Settings”选项卡,然后点击“GitHub Pages”,在这里,你可以设置你的网站的分支为“gh-pages”,这样GitHub就会自动为你生成一个静态网站。,5、等待DNS解析生效, ,由于GitHub Pages使用的是CNAME记录,所以你需要等待一段时间让DNS解析生效,通常情况下,这个过程需要几分钟到几小时不等,你可以使用在线DNS查询工具(如https://www.whatsmydns.net/)查看你的域名是否已经解析成功。,6、在浏览器中访问你的网站,当你看到浏览器地址栏显示你的域名时,说明你的网站已经成功搭建并可以通过互联网访问了,你可以根据需要对网站进行进一步的定制和优化。,1、如何更改域名?,如果你想使用自己的域名而不是GitHub Pages提供的默认域名(如yourusername.github.io),你需要先购买一个域名,然后将其指向你的GitHub仓库的CNAME记录,具体操作方法如下:,登录域名注册商的控制面板;,在域名管理页面找到“添加记录”或“添加CNAME记录”选项;,输入你的GitHub仓库的CNAME记录(格式为: yourname.github.io);,点击“保存”或“提交”按钮。,2、如何自定义网站主题?, ,如果你想让你的网站看起来更专业一些,可以考虑使用一些现成的网站主题,许多开源的主题都可以在GitHub上找到,或者你可以自己编写主题,要使用第三方主题,只需将其下载到本地,然后按照主题提供的说明进行安装和配置即可。,3、如何提高网站性能?,为了提高网站的加载速度和性能,你可以采取以下措施:,压缩图片和CSS、JavaScript文件;,使用 CDN(内容分发网络)加速静态资源的传输;,使用缓存技术(如Varnish或Redis)减轻服务器压力;,对数据库进行优化,减少查询时间;,使用HTTP/2协议提高网页加载速度。,您可以使用免费主机试用来搭建网站。以下是一些免费主机试用的推荐:,,1. AWS 免费套餐:这些免费套餐产品在 12 个月的 AWS 免费套餐期限到期后不会自动过期,而是无期限地提供给现有的和新的 AWS 客户。,2. Bluehost:Bluehost 提供了一个简单的过程来创建您的第一个网站。,3. SiteGround:SiteGround 是一个流行的托管服务提供商,它提供了一个简单的过程来创建您的第一个网站。

CDN资讯